Перейти к содержимому

LucianGod

Пользователи
  • Публикации

    4
  • Зарегистрирован

  • Посещение

Сообщения, опубликованные пользователем LucianGod


  1. а что если . . . 

    Захардкодить замену стержней ? И Привязать их к времени. 
    Иначе говоря, жестко менять стержни, по истечении времени (время определим опытным путем).
    Запуск реакторов делать последовательно с задержкой.

     

    48 минут назад, Taoshi сказал:

    Действительно, почти предел для сервера с 3-мя компонентными шинами. Но это при условии, что ядерный реактор с картинки всё ещё поддерживает включение/выключение сигналом красного камня. В ином случае нужен не только контроллер красного камня, но и адаптер на каждый реактор. А это уже 100 устройств и минимум 2а сервера.

    А если память не изменяет, то интерфейс включения\выключения доступен и без редстоун сигнала (но это не точно).
     

     

    50 минут назад, Taoshi сказал:

     

    1. В ТЗ указана задача "заменить", для неё существует отдельный механизм, правда работающий с 100к lzh-конденсаторами, а не с 60к coolant cell. А работает ли транспозер стандартно на сервере? Он бы мог заменить, но выставлено условие замены трубами, а у них нет такого функционала.

     

     Думаю, что можно заменять и МЭ сетью, а не трубами.


  2. 33 минуты назад, eu_tomat сказал:

    Что за ограничения территории и функциональных блоков? Для 50 реакторов территория с функциональными блоками нашлись, а для компьютеров — нет? О чём тут вообще речь? На каком сервере такие ограничения?

    Я не помню, есть ли ограничения на компьютеры, я к этому.
     

    35 минут назад, eu_tomat сказал:

    Проблема в том, что при сильных лагах, пока происходит замена охлаждающих ячеек в одних реакторах, остальные могут взорваться, не дождавшись своевременной замены.

    Да. теперь дошло.


  3. 6 минут назад, eu_tomat сказал:

    А на чём основаны подсчёты? Теоретически можно больше 50 реакторов обслужить с запасом, но для конкретного сервера в конкретный период времени нужны замеры.

    Все согласно вашим подсчетам, из сообщения выше.
    20 тактов = 1 секунда, по такту на включение выключение, по ~36 на изъятие\вставку новых элементов.
    итого ~38 тактов на реактор * 50 / 20 = 95 секунд. на смену всех.
    Соответственно если система работает на 25 реакторов, то затраты на время будут в 2 раза меньше. 
    +- затраты лагов сервера.

    Насчет больше 50 реакторов, то тут я не в курсе, но по цифрам - это почти предел. Если обрабатывать их линейно.
     

    20 минут назад, eu_tomat сказал:

    Ещё одно важное замечание: на лагающих серверах приоритетной задачей компьютера является не замена компонентов, а отключение реактора. А когда реакторов много, то начинать отключение реакторов приходится сильно заранее, что приводит к их простою.

    Тут не вижу проблемы, если отключать реактор непосредственно перед заменой. Пока остальные работают.

     

    26 минут назад, eu_tomat сказал:

    . . .Кстати, а что мешает установить по компьютеру в каждом чанке?

    1. Ограничение в кол-во функциональных блоков на юзера
    2. Ограниченная территория

    Однако думаю, что это не проблемы. 


    Итого я свожу к тому, что необходимо ставить больше компьютеров.


  4. @eu_tomat А как насчет многопоточности ? Если запускать хотя бы в двух потоках по 25 ректоров.
    Как я понимаю, потоки == процессы в моде. И они должны работать асинхронно. Приведет это к таким же задержкам ?
    Или под капотом, они выполняются все аля v8 схеме ? 
    Мне бы хотелось знать оценку рентабельности.  

    update:
    По подсчетам, тактов для обработки ~25 реакторов должно быть хватать с запасом, поэтому кол-во может варьироваться. 

    update 2:
    Нельзя согласно этому треду

×
×
  • Создать...